Incumbent Cheryl Fuller holds a strong position in the Central Coast Council mayoral race, with trader consensus reflecting the absence of prominent challengers as of mid-2026. Local reporting indicates she confirmed plans to seek a second term, prioritizing council finances, while no sitting councillors have declared a mayoral bid and Garry Carpenter has signaled possible retirement amid other commitments. The October 27, 2026, Tasmanian local government elections remain the resolution trigger, with the Tasmanian Electoral Commission declaring results. Limited candidate announcements and Fuller's prior 2022 victory margin continue to shape the implied probabilities ahead of any late entries.
